Official synopsis Publisher

2016 Reprint of 1909 Edition. Full facsimile of the original edition, not reproduced with Optical Recognition Software. “There are about 3500 words in the Bible that most of us can’t understand because their meaning is not translated into English. These are biblical names. Yet 2 Timothy 3:16 says that “all Scripture” or “every Scripture” is given by inspiration and is profitable. Therefore, we can gain profitable spiritual truth and instruction from these names, although the reason for some names is not immediately obvious. Some are much clearer, such as Timothy, meaning “honoring God.” He certainly honored God from his youth, up. This scholarly dictionary by James Beaumont Jackson was first published in 1909 after eleven years of hard work.”-Introduction. From Aaron to Zuriel, this simple yet valuable resource will inform the study of the bible.
